Wood Carving: Design And Workmanship is a book written by George Jack and published in 1903. This book is a comprehensive guide to the art of wood carving, covering everything from the basic tools and materials needed to the intricacies of design and technique. The author provides detailed instructions on how to carve various types of wood, including hard and softwoods, and how to achieve different finishes and textures. The book also includes numerous illustrations and photographs that demonstrate the various techniques and designs discussed. Additionally, the author provides guidance on how to select and prepare wood for carving, including tips on how to choose the right type of wood and how to properly dry and store it.
